【安全指南】Windows 11系统组件优化:3大风险规避与专业操作指南
【免费下载链接】Win11Debloat一个简单的PowerShell脚本,用于从Windows中移除预装的无用软件,禁用遥测,从Windows搜索中移除Bing,以及执行各种其他更改以简化和改善你的Windows体验。此脚本适用于Windows 10和Windows 11。项目地址: https://gitcode.com/GitHub_Trending/wi/Win11Debloat
一、识别系统风险组件
1.1 风险等级评估体系
系统组件删除操作存在三级风险等级,需根据实际需求评估:
- 高风险:删除后导致核心功能失效且无法通过常规手段恢复
- 中风险:影响特定场景功能,但可通过应用商店重新安装
- 低风险:仅影响非核心体验,系统基础功能不受影响
1.2 常见误操作案例分析
| 误操作场景 | 风险等级 | 后果 | 恢复难度 |
|---|---|---|---|
| 删除Microsoft.WindowsStore | 高 | 无法安装新应用,设置界面异常 | 需重装系统 |
| 卸载Microsoft.Edge | 中 | 部分系统通知无法打开 | 可通过离线包恢复 |
| 禁用WindowsTerminal | 中 | PowerShell无法运行 | 需命令行重建 |
| 移除Microsoft.Paint | 低 | 无法打开简单图像 | 应用商店可恢复 |
二、系统组件分类指南
2.1 核心功能组件(高风险)
此类组件确保系统基础运行,绝对禁止删除:
- Microsoft.WindowsCalculator:系统计算功能支撑
- Microsoft.WindowsCamera:摄像头硬件接口服务
- Microsoft.WindowsNotepad:文本处理基础组件
- Microsoft.Windows.Photos:图像解码与显示引擎
- Microsoft.ScreenSketch:系统截图架构服务
- Microsoft.WindowsStore:应用生态核心(官方文档明确标注不可恢复)
2.2 扩展服务组件(中风险)
提供增强功能,建议保留:
- 网络服务:Microsoft.YourPhone(设备互联)、Microsoft.RemoteDesktop(远程控制)
- 系统工具:Microsoft.GetHelp(诊断服务)、Microsoft.WindowsTerminal(命令行环境)
- 安全组件:Windows.SecurityCenter(安全中心)、Microsoft Defender相关服务
2.3 场景化工具(低风险)
根据使用场景选择性保留:
- 办公场景:Microsoft.windowscommunicationsapps(邮件日历)、Microsoft.OutlookForWindows
- 游戏场景:Microsoft.GamingApp、Microsoft.XboxGameOverlay
- 开发场景:Microsoft.PowerAutomateDesktop、Microsoft.Windows.DevHome
三、执行安全清理操作
3.1 前置准备:创建系统还原点
# 以管理员身份执行 Create-SystemRestorePoint -Description "Win11Debloat优化前备份" -RestorePointType MODIFY_SETTINGS官方文档出处:Win11Debloat项目README.md的"Pre-execution Checklist"章节
3.2 自定义清理配置
- 编辑项目根目录下的
Appslist.txt文件 - 第1-99行为默认删除项,第100行后为安全保留项
- 保留项需在应用名称前添加
#注释符号,例如:
- Microsoft.OneDrive # OneDrive consumer cloud storage client +#Microsoft.OneDrive # OneDrive consumer cloud storage client3.3 运行优化脚本
# 双击运行项目根目录下的Run.bat # 在菜单中选择对应模式: # (1) Default mode:应用推荐配置 # (2) Custom mode:手动选择优化项 # (3) App removal mode:仅移除应用
图:Win11Debloat脚本主菜单界面,提供多种优化模式选择
四、避坑要点与专业建议
4.1 注册表操作警示
Regfiles/目录下的.reg文件包含系统核心设置,非专业用户禁止手动修改:
- 高风险项:Disable_Edge_AI_Features.reg、Disable_Windows_Suggestions.reg
- 建议操作:通过脚本菜单选择预设配置,避免直接编辑注册表
4.2 组件依赖关系说明
部分应用存在隐性依赖,例如:
- Microsoft.XboxIdentityProvider是所有Xbox相关应用的基础
- Microsoft.EdgeWebView2Runtime被多个UWP应用依赖
- 删除AD2F1837开头的硬件驱动可能导致设备检测异常
4.3 恢复策略
- 系统组件:设置 > 应用 > 可选功能 > 添加功能
- 商店应用:Microsoft Store搜索应用名称重新安装
- 严重故障:使用前期创建的系统还原点恢复
专业建议:每次执行优化前,通过Get.ps1脚本备份当前配置,以便出现问题时快速回滚。定期查看项目更新日志,作者会根据Windows 11版本更新安全配置策略。
【免费下载链接】Win11Debloat一个简单的PowerShell脚本,用于从Windows中移除预装的无用软件,禁用遥测,从Windows搜索中移除Bing,以及执行各种其他更改以简化和改善你的Windows体验。此脚本适用于Windows 10和Windows 11。项目地址: https://gitcode.com/GitHub_Trending/wi/Win11Debloat
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考